Dance program to present its BFA Capstone Concert June 1 and 2

Western Washington University's Theatre and Dance Department will present its annual Bachelor of Fine Arts Capstone Concert at 7:30 p.m. on Friday and Saturday, June 1 and 2, in room 16 of the Performing Arts Center.

The Capstone Concert showcases the dance program's BFA candidates in their culminating projects of performance and choreography. The candidates spend their final year working with a guest choreographer and creating a solo that artistically concludes their career at Western.

The evening concert will showcase original BFA candidate work in which dancers, actors, and movers are premiered in group pieces. These unique performances stem from the very essence of dance and movement and strive to challenge and inspire choreographers, dancers, and the audience.
